Key Responsibilities :
- Strategic Vision & Leadership : Work closely with the Board of Directors to develop and execute a strategic plan that aligns with the organization’s mission, vision, and values. Provide leadership to inspire and motivate staff at all levels.
- Operational Excellence : Oversee the strategic operations of the organization, ensuring the efficient delivery of services, compliance with regulatory requirements, and alignment with best practices in behavioral health.
- Financial Management : Maintain fiscal responsibility, including overseeing budgeting, financial planning, and resource allocation. Drive initiatives to secure funding through grants, partnerships, and revenue-generation models.
- Community Engagement & Advocacy : Strengthen partnerships with local, state, and national stakeholders, advocating for behavioral health policies that benefit the community. Build relationships with community leaders and external partners to raise awareness and support for our mission.
- Organizational Culture : Foster a positive, collaborative, and inclusive workplace culture. Encourage professional development, support staff well-being, and ensure effective communication across all levels of the organization.
- Governance & Compliance : Ensure compliance with all applicable laws, regulations, and accreditation standards. Work closely with the Board to support governance processes and ensure accountability.
